PostHeaderIcon Google Cell Phone- Nexus One

nexus_8

The Nexus One has been confirmed to be the renowned Google phone by Cory O’Brien, a San Francisco marketer, in a Twitter update. A photo proves the phone that gazes like the leaked HTC Passion. The Android 2.1-powered cell phone has a 3.5- to 3.7-inch OLED touchscreen, a five-megapixel camera, a trackball, GPS and Wi-Fi connectivity. A few sources have already mentioned that the Google phone would run on the T-Mobile 3G network.

PostHeaderIcon T-Mobile Pulse Will Come Early October

T-Mobile Pulse

Until now, we’ve found out that the Android-powered Huawei U8220 is coming to T-Mobile Europe as T-Mobile Pulse, but without having details about its price and release date.

Well, it looks like the unannounced Android smartphone will be available starting October this year. At least that’s what a report from Tweakers.net says.

The Pulse U8220 has just appeared on pre-order at a Dutch retailer’s website, priced at €257 (about $366) – free of contract, but locked on T-Mobile’s network.

Although resembling the previous photo of the Pulse, the images made available by the retailer seem to be showing only a reference design, so the final product may look different.

Here’s what we’ve got so far regarding the specs of T-Mobile Pulse / Huawei U8220:

* 3.5 inch touchscreen display with 320 x 480 pixels
* HSDPA 7.2 Mbps and HSUPA 5.76 Mbps
* Wi-Fi
* GPS
* Microsoft Exchange support
* Bluetooth 2.0
* 3.2MP camera
* MicroSD card support

PostHeaderIcon Dell’s Android Smartphone

Computer maker Dell (DELL) was expected to launch a Android-based mobile phone in China a few days ago, but it hasn’t happened yet. However, it seems that this device is all but ready since the specifications list of the device have emerged, along with some photos.

Specifications:

* Quad-band GSM/GPRS/EDGE class 12

* Size: 68.6cc

* 103g grams weight

* Dimensions: 58 x 122 x 11.7mm

* Display: 3.5″ nHD 640×360 LCD, 18-bit, 262K colors

* OTA capable

* Microsoft Exchange support

* Google, AIM, Yahoo and MSN IM support

* 3 megapixel auto-focus, flash, 8x digital zoom camera with 30fps video shooting mode, built in photo editor

* USB 2.0, Bluetooth 2.0 + EDR

* A-GPS

* On-screen QWERTY keyboard, hardwriting recognition, multi touch UI

* MicroSD slot

Though it is only available in China now, there’s a chance that this or a similar Dell device will be hitting stores stateside.

PostHeaderIcon Two Motorola Android Smartphones’ Specs

Rumors are running everywhere that Motorola are planning to launch two new Android smartphones some time in 2009. One is the Sholes and the other is the Morrison. Now, the Android and Me guys has just leaked the purported spec list. Let’s have a see.

Motorola Morrison Specs:

CPU: Qualcomm MSM7201A 528 MHz

Memory: 256MB RAM

Flash Rom: 512 MB

Memory Card Type: microSDHC, Class 6, 32 GB supported (max)

Display: 320×480 (HVGA)

Accelerometer: 3-axis, Four-way screen rotation

Magnetometer; Proximity Sensor; Ambient Light Sensor

Voice Bands: GSM 850/900/1800/1900, W-CDMA 900/(1700 or 1900)/2100

Wireless: 802.11 b/g, WEP, WPA, 802.11i (WPA2)

Bluetooth Version: 2.0 + EDR

Bluetooth Profiles: A2DP, AVRCP, GAP, HFP 1.5, HSP, SDAP, SPP

USB: USB 2.0 High Speed, Micro USB connector

Headset Jack: 3.5mm, Stereo out, Mic

Camera Resolution: 5 megapixels

Image Capture Resolution (max): 2560×1920

Camera Features: Autofocus, White Balance, Geotagging, Color Effects

Camera Digital Zoom (max): 5.4x

Video Recording Resolution: 320×240 (QVGA)

Video Recording Frame Rate: 25 fps

Location Services: Standalone GPS w/ internal antenna, Assisted GPS, E-Compass

The Motorola Morrison will be a budget handset, but it’s still a pretty solid little smartphone. Expected on T-Mobile’s network, the Morrison is rumored for an October 21 release, but no price.

Motorola Sholes Specs:

CPU: OMAP3430 – 600 MHz ARM Cortex A8 + PowerVR SGX 530 GPU + 430MHz C64x+ DSP + ISP (Image Signal Processor)

Dimensions: 60.00 x 115.80 x 13.70 mm

Weight: 169 g

Battery: Li-ion 1400 mAh.

Standby 450 hours, talk time 420 minutes

3.7-inch touch-sensitive display with a resolution of 854×480 pixels, 16 million color depth. Physical screen size is 45.72 mm by 81.34 mm.

512MB/256MB ROM/RAM

microSD / microSDHC expansion slot

Camera: 5.0 megapixel with autofocus and video recorder

Connectivity: USB2.0, 3.5mm audio jack, Bluetooth 2.0 + EDR, Wi-Fi

Supported audio formats: AMR-NB/WB, MP3, PCM / WAV, AAC, AAC +, eAAC +, WMA

Supported video formats: MPEG-4, H.263, H.264, WMV

GPS navigation

The Motorola Sholes is said to come on Verizon’s network, and is rumored for a November release. The expected retail price for the Motorola Sholes (with a Verizon contract) is $199.
